ADAS system has to be calibrated after glass sliding doors repair is installed

If you have recently replaced your auto glass, you may require to have your ADAS system calibrated. This is essential to ensure that the new glass functions correctly. Calibration can also be used to safeguard your passengers and the driver of your vehicle.

Auto glass services will carry out ADAS calibration following the installation of the new windshield. They will make sure that the sensors function correctly. The sensors will be in proper alignment with the car's radars, cameras, and lasers.

ADAS, an advanced driver assistance system, can increase your safety. It assists you in avoiding collisions by making use of various safety features. These safety features include adaptive cruise control as well as automatic braking. ADAS can also assist with keeping a lane. ADAS can be found on the windshield of your car, as well as in the side-view mirrors and front bumpers.

ADAS systems are crucial to your security. However, they must be calibrated to work properly. After you have installed the new windshield it is recommended to check it by a technician. ADAS sensor calibration is often required when installing new tires, when changing the suspension, or after a suspension change.

Advanced computer diagnostics are needed to ensure ADAS calibration. A master technician will have to use specialized equipment to ensure that the ADAS system is properly set up.

ADAS can monitor the environment of your vehicle and alert you to potential dangers. However, if the system isn't properly calibrated, it could be a cause of an accident or malfunction.

After a car accident ADAS systems need to be calibrated. An accident can change the position of the sensors on your windshield, which can cause them to fail to perform properly. Your windshield may also be misaligned, which could put everyone in the car at risk.

After replacing a windshield ADAS cameras need to be calibrated. The reason is that the camera could be out of alignment with windshield. If this happens it means that the ADAS system won't be able detect changes in driving conditions.
